
It looks like the Foo Fighters are making good on their recent promise to return with the announcement that they’re headlining the upcoming, three-day, Boston Calling festival along with Paramore and The Lumineers over Memorial Day Weekend, May 26 through 28, 2023.

Headlining Friday, May 26 are the Foo Fighters in the band's first non-tribute performance since the passing of drummer Taylor Hawkins, followed by The Lumineers’ headlining set on Saturday, May 27, and finally, Paramore closing out the festival on Sunday, May 28.
Check out the full lineup below, also featuring scheduled appearances by Alanis Morissette, Yeah Yeah Yeahs, Bleachers, Queens of the Stone Age, The National, Niall Horan, The Flaming Lips, Maren Morris, and tons more.
